As the Director of the Criminal Investigation and Detection Group (CIDG), Police Director Benjamin Magalong was appointed to chair the Philippine National Police (PNP) Board of Inquiry (BOI) following the tragic January 25, 2015, Mamasapano clash. He was tasked with leading an independent, fact-finding investigation into "Oplan Exodus," a botched anti-terrorist operation that resulted in the deaths of 44 Special Action Force (SAF) commandos. Demonstrating exceptional integrity despite immense political pressure, Magalong directed a transparent investigation and authored a comprehensive 128-page report submitted in March 2015. The uncompromising report famously concluded that the PNP chain of command had been bypassed, holding high-ranking officials—including then-President Benigno Aquino III and suspended PNP Chief Alan Purisima—accountable for critical operational and strategic failures. This deed cemented Magalong's reputation for strict public accountability and unwavering commitment to the truth.
